Picture Room Measurements Notes
Main Accommodation
Ground Floor
Entrance HallStep into this fabulous property through a timber entrance door, accompanied by a welcoming side window that floods the space with natural light. The central entrance hall sets the tone for the home, boasting a tiled floor, and a staircase leading to the first floor, creating an inviting atmosphere from the moment you enter.
Sitting Room5.18m x 3.45mThe sitting room exudes warmth and comfort, featuring a generous layout bathed in natural light from a uPVC double-glazed window facing the front. Double opening doors lead to the sitting room extension, while a wall-mounted electric fire adds a cosy focal point. With elegant ceiling coving and a ceiling rose, this room is perfect for relaxing or entertaining.
Dining Room3.18m x 2.1mA versatile addition to the home, the dining room is illuminated by natural light streaming in through French style doors opening onto the patio terrace, as well as a rear-facing window offering garden views. With its tiled floor covering, inset spotlights, and ample space, this room is ideal for hosting gatherings or enjoying family meals.
Kitchen4.5m x 3.12mThe heart of the home, the kitchen boasts dual aspects with uPVC double-glazed windows to both the front and rear, providing a bright and airy ambiance. Featuring maple effect shaker style units, laminated work-surfaces, and extensive tiling, this kitchen is as stylish as it is functional. Complete with modern appliances and built-in storage, it’s a chef’s delight.
First Floor
LandingAscend the staircase to the first floor landing, where a rear-facing uPVC double-glazed window illuminates the space. With inset spotlights, and access to a partly boarded loft space, this landing offers access to the two bedrooms and house bathroom.
Master Bedroom4.55m x 3.15mThe principal bedroom is a spacious retreat, flooded with light from uPVC double-glazed windows to both the front and rear. With ceiling coving and a cosy radiator, this room provides a tranquil sanctuary.
Bedroom 23.2m x 2.97mAnother naturally light bedroom awaits, featuring a uPVC double-glazed window facing the front and two built-in storage cupboards. With ceiling coving, a dado rail, and a radiator, this room offers comfort and convenience.
Bathroom2.26m x 1.45mThe bathroom is smartly appointed with a three-piece suite in white, complemented by extensive wall tiling. Featuring a panelled bath with a fitted shower, wash hand basin, and low flush WC, this space is both stylish and functional.
Outside
Front GardenSituated in the desirable Bilton Grange district of East Hull, Thanet Road offers a prime residential locale. Easily identifiable by the Reeds Rains For Sale sign, this property benefits from its established surroundings. Enclosed within the property’s boundaries, the front garden presents a generous expanse of well-maintained lawn. A central gated pathway guides visitors to the front door, adding to the property’s curb appeal.
Rear GardenThe rear garden serves as a delightful extension to this charming home, boasting views overlooking Thanet Primary School. With ample proportions, the garden features a lush lawn, a convenient patio/terrace area, a practical shed, and amenities including an external tap and light. A timber gate grants access to the shared rear pedestrian pathway, enhancing convenience and accessibility.
